HOT WEATHER REMINDER
With high temperatures and humidity expected today, Tuesday, July 14, community members are encouraged to take precautions to stay safe during the heat.
Heat Safety Tips:
- Drink plenty of water, even if you don't feel thirsty.
- Limit outdoor activities and stay in the shade or indoors whenever possible.
- Stay in air-conditioned spaces when you can.
- Check in on elders, neighbours, and those who may be more vulnerable to the heat.
- Keep pets cool and ensure they have access to fresh water.
Heat-related illness can become serious very quickly. If you or someone you know is experiencing symptoms such as confusion, fainting, difficulty breathing, or loss of consciousness, don't wait — seek emergency assistance immediately.
